Amar comes from the same Arabic root '-m-r as Umar, meaning "to thrive" or build up, shared with Ammar ibn Yasir, an early companion who endured persecution alongside his parents.

Etymology

From the Arabic root ع-م-ر (ʿ-m-r, 'to live long, flourish'). Amar means 'long life' - related to Umar/Amr.

Islamic Significance

Life is framed in the Quran as a test rather than a possession: he created death and life to test which of you is best in deed (67:2).
